 To kick off the holiday season, The Detroit Department of Transportation (DDOT) is rolling out a holiday- themed bus campaign on a select number of DDOT buses. The holiday buses, sponsored by the Quicken Loans Community Investment Fund (QLCIF) and DTE, will go into service today, Tuesday, December 12th and will remain on the roads until January 31st.
A cheerful theme will cover the outside of the buses and the interior will feature holiday lights, garland and other festive decorations, offering riders a fun and creative setting as they travel to their destinations throughout Detroit. On a select number of routes, customers will be able to ride free of charge on Saturdays.
In an effort to promote DDOT as a convenient way to access downtown activities, beginning December 16th the department will offer complimentary fare on one featured downtown route each Saturday. Complimentary rides will be provided from 7AM – 11PM. The routes will provide residents a chance to visit downtown to enjoy events such as Winter in Detroit and the Downtown Detroit Markets.
To ensure all Detroiters will have the opportunity to enjoy the holiday bus experience, the decorated buses will not be assigned to specific routes. Instead, the buses will be mixed in across several routes servicing the west side, east side and coming into downtown on any given day and time.
Timing of the holiday buses will not be made public in advance, as DDOT would like to create a fun surprise for riders when the holiday bus arrives. Regular bus schedules are available online. The complimentary fare schedule is as follows:
Dec 16: 53 Woodward
Dec 23: 34 Gratiot
Dec 30: 25 Jefferson
Jan 6: 37 Michigan
Jan 13: 21 Grand River
